The Natural Bridges State Beach is a state park, natural monument, and protected beach area in Santa Cruz, California. It is quite a popular beach park, mostly due to its stunning scenery and location.

Named after a natural bridge that serves as a popular landmark and located inside the park, the Natural Bridges State Beach is commonly described as “breathtaking”, “beautiful”, “wonderful”, “lovely”, “gorgeous”, and “amazing”. Most previous and recurring visitors will tell you how great the place is and how much you’ll enjoy picnicking, fishing, surfing, or just simply hanging out on the sandy beach. There are also tons of things to see here, including migrating whales, seals, otters, and shore birds. Tide pools also offer a glimpse of sea creatures like crabs, sea stars, and anemones just to name a few.

Be careful of the seagulls that fly around the park, though, as they can snatch away your food.
